one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method over the internet through which a lengthy URL can be transformed right into a shorter, far more workable type. This shortened URL redirects to the original extensive URL when frequented. Providers like Bitly and TinyURL are well-known exam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social networking platforms like Twitter, where character restrictions for posts designed it challenging to share lengthy URLs.

Past social media marketing, URL shorteners are practical in promoting campaigns, email messages, and printed media where by lengthy URLs could be cumbersome.

2. Core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ally includes the subsequent parts:

World-wide-web Interface: Here is the front-finish part in which consumers can enter their lengthy URLs and get shortened variations. It can be a simple sort over a Web content.
Databases: A database is important to keep the mapping amongst the first extensive URL and the shortened version.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L options like MongoDB can be employed.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that can take the shorter URL and redirects the person on the corresponding extended URL. This logic is normally implemented in the internet server or an software layer.
API: Lots of URL shorteners provide an API to make sure that 3rd-celebration program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original long URLs.
3.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a short one. Various procedures is often employed, for instance:

Hashing: The very long URL could be hashed into a set-sizing string, which serves as the brief URL. Nonetheless, hash collisions (various URLs leading to precisely the same h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ular typical technique is to make use of Base62 encoding (which works by using sixty two people: 0-nine,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ry during the databases. This technique makes sure that the limited URL is as short as feasible.
Random String Technology: An additional method would be to generate a random string of a fixed duration (e.g., six figures) and Verify if it’s presently in use in the database. If not, it’s assigned to the long URL.
four. Database Administration
The database schema for any URL shortener is generally straightforward, with two primary f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Lengthy UR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Small URL/Slug: The short Edition with the URL, often stored as a singular string.
In combination with these, you might like to retail outlet metadata such as the creation day, expiration date, and the quantity of situations the quick URL has actually been acc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ection can be a significant part of the URL shortener's operation. Each time a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the company needs to speedily retrieve the first URL within the databases and redirect the user utilizing an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) position code.

Functionality is key below, as the process really should be practically instantaneous. Procedures like database indexing and caching (e.g., working with Redis or Memcached) may be used to speed up the retrieval method.

six. Security Factors
Stability is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-occasion stability solutions to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Prevention: Charge restricting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ers endeavoring to generate A huge number of limited URLs.
7. Scalability
As being the URL shortener grows, it might require to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, perhaps invol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ute site visitors across several servers to deal with large loads.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ate concerns like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into various solutions to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ners generally present analytics to track how often a brief URL is clicked, wherever the website traffic is coming from, and also other valuable metrics. This needs log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
